ZIP 58734 and ZIP 58737 are ZIP Code areas in North Dakota.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.
ZIP 58734 has the higher population (211 vs 148 in ZIP 58737). ZIP 58737 has the higher median household income ($108,500 vs $68,958 in ZIP 58734). Since 2019, ZIP 58737's population has grown faster (-19.6% vs -39.9%).
